Dress Code

Collarless or Sleeveless ShirtsTops (Note: Shirts worn by gentlemen must be worn tucked in on the golf course). Brief or Strapless Suntops are not permitted.

Tailored Shorts (no shorter than 2" above the knee) or 3/4 length trousers with knee-length socks, predominantly white sports socks or trainer socks. Both gentlemen and ladies may wear shoes or sandals without socks in the clubhouse. (Note: Tennis, Athletic or Beach shorts are not permitted).

Spiked or Rubber Soled Golf Shoes. Note: Caddies, spectators and juniors of 12 years and under are permitted to wear training shoes on the golf course
